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Jade Youlong Food Farm
Jade Youlong Food Farm
翡翠游龙美食农庄
Chinese Cuisine ·
Pudong, Shanghai
Directions
Similar Places Nearby
More
Shanghai Yanyou Longliyan Center
Sunny Villa
Xiaomeiman Restaurant
Jinfumen Chuansha Branch
Hushangyou Bianwang (Pudong)
Shihaodian Bisite Shopping Center Branch
Details
Hours
Every Day
10:30
AM
-
2:00
PM
4:30
PM
-
8:30
PM
Closing Soon
Address
No.20, Xinchun Road (Youlongshi Culture Popularization of Science Museum National AAA Ji Scenic Area), Pudong
Shanghai China
More on
Amap